压力钢带式CVT滑转率理论分析与精确测算方法研究 被引量:1

Research on Theoretical Analysis and Accurate Measuring Method for Slip Rate of V-belt CVT

摘要 针对滑转率现有的测量方法和计算方法的不足,分析了产生测量和计算偏差的原因,将金属带回转中心的偏移理论引入到滑转率的计算模型中,提出了一种新的滑转率测量与计算模型。并以该模型为基础设计了滑转率测量试验装置。试验结果表明,新的测算模型达到了纠正原有方法偏差、实现高精度测算CVT滑转率的目标。 According to the deficiency of current measuring and calculating method for slip rate,the reasons for measuring and calculating error are analyzed,and a new measuring and calculating model for slip rate is presented by introducing the deflection theory of V-beh rotation center into the calculation model of slip rate.The test equipment for slip rate measurement is designed based on this model,and the test results indicate that the new model achieves the goals for correcting original method error and realizing high measuring and calculating accuracy of CVT slip rate.
